Funding of religious organizations in Chile

Year: 2006
Authors: Ana María Celis
Keywords: funding, religious organizations, worship funding, patronage law, tithe

Analysis of the regulatory and historical evolution of the funding of religious organizations in Chile, from the collection of the tithe in the colonial period and patronage laws, to the current system without specific mechanisms and the relationship between Church and State. The role of the State in funding is reviewed, along with the last legal system for converting the tithe, and the transition toward recognition of freedom of worship.
